Overall, I'd say you're doing pretty good for the time you've been playing! You're a little pitchy here and there, but that's to be expected as you're still developing your bar and tuning skills. The steel is loud in spots, and you're drowning out the vocalist and what little rhythm there is, but that can be "fixed in the remix". Other than that, I'd say you might also try adding some lower voicings on the steel to fatten things up, and provide contrast for the singer's voice.

It's a good first effort.
